Deep purple blooms that actually do have a chocolate hue and will give you bundles of flowers all summer long
Try with other deep velvety colours, like Astrantia major ‘Ruby Cloud’ or Cosmos bipinnatus 'Rubenza'.
Thriving in full sun and well-drained soil, it’s ideal for bringing a sense of structure to borders.
